DEALING IN SECURITIES BY A DIRECTOR OF A SUBSIDIARY COMPANY

In compliance with paragraphs 3.63 to 3.74 of the JSE Limited Listings
Requirements, the following information is disclosed.

Name of director                     :      Leonard Maxwell de Villiers
Name of Company                      :      Bayport Financial Services 2010 Proprietary
                                            Limited a subsidiary company of Transaction
                                            Capital
Date of transaction                  :      14 March 2013
Price per security                   :      720 cents
Class of securities                  :      Ordinary shares
Number of securities                 :      27 435
Total transaction value              :      R197 532
Nature of transaction                :      On market sale of ordinary shares
Nature and extent of the interest
of the director                      :      Direct beneficial
Clearance obtained                   :      Yes
